The Xbox 360 beat all other systems to the next gen punch. That head start really shows. They have some great games and the Halo franchise is one of my favorites. The system also has some great innovations on the horizon in Project Natal. Project Natal could change the way we play games all together, but we have heard that before. It would allow the user to play with no controller and all motions are controlled by your body. I also feel that while beating all other competition to the market, they may have skipped out on the quality of the system. The dreaded red ring of death has claimed my first xbox.

Every time I turn my new one on I still wonder if this is the time it happens again. I have been a subscriber of live since week one over six years ago. The $50 price for a year subscription is a small price. It allows me to play online with my friends, voice and video chat, download tv show, movies and even stream Netflix®. The system is starting to show it age and the ps3 is starting to get some momentum and might even over take the 360. But with the Xbox 360’s new price drop the battle is on. In closing the Xbox 360 is a sure bet for any Man Cave.

     Believe it or not I am still asked this question. Since its release my answer has always been “yes”. With the new price drop , new restyling and some great games as of late there is no reason not to have one.  For any guy or gal that’s into sports games, this is without a doubt the right system for you. MLB The Show is the best baseball game I have played in the past few years. The PS3 also offers other awesome exclusive titles along with a vast selection of movies to rent or buy.

      The Blu-Ray player is outstanding; the PlayStation store has really come on as of late and with constant updates it keeps the system fresh and enjoyable.  The system has come along way since it was released and it keeps getting better.      Gaming chairs have come a long way since the wedge shaped chair that was used in the days of Nintendo. The E1000 Gaming Chair by Repose is, in my opinion, the best gaming chair out there. This thing has built in 2.1 sound system jacks to plug in an mp3 player, a jack for headphones, and even a swing out cup holder. You can even hook another chair up to yours so you can share in the sound. Now, I love my simple 5.1 surround system but the sound that comes from this chair is so crisp and clear that you swear it’s not just a 2.1 system.

The comfort of this chair is top notch. The manufacturer of this chair also makes top of the line massage chairs, and believe me, when the sub starts going this becomes a massage chair.  It gives you the ability to fold it up for storage, but why do that? You can get it in a few different colors and it looks good in any man cave. With a $450 dollar price tag it is a bit steep but there are no regrets or buyer’s remorse with this chair.
